Columbia Records, for example, had pressing plants in Pitman, NJ, Terre Haute, IN, and Santa Maria, CA. In order to cut down on shipping costs, most major labels had pressing plants in different parts of the country - typically on the East Coast, in the Midwest, and on the West Coast. In the heyday of LPs - the 1960s, 70s, and 80s, the vast majority of US releases were pressed by plants owned by the major labels such as Columbia, Capitol, and RCA, or by the major independent manufacturers such as Specialty, Rainbo, Monarch, and Presswell. Luckily for us, many of the major record manufacturers have different sized rings, which often allows us to figure out where a record was manufactured even if there is no indication in the dead wax. The size of the rings depends on the size of the die that the pressing plant used to hold its stampers in place. When record presses squeeze a biscuit of vinyl, they create a pressing ring (or rings) on each side of the label. However, even if they didn't put the code on the label, we could probably figure out the pressing plant anyway, either by looking for MR, PR, or PRC in the dead wax, or by checking the size of the pressing ring - as long as you know that the pressing rings for Monarch, Presswell, and Philips are 73mm, 32/70mm, and 70mm, respectively. That indicates that the three albums were pressed by: Monarch Records, Los Angeles Presswell Records, Ancora, NJ and Philips Recording Corp., Richmond, IN. If you click on the photo above to enlarge it, you can clearly see that the codes on the three copies of Deja Vu from left to right are MO, PR, and RI. Martin famously categorized writers into two types: "architects" and "gardeners." He says that architect writers may plan and outline every step of their story well in advance, while gardeners like himself cultivate ideas and see where they lead. These new Epiphones were based on existing Matsumoku guitars, sharing body shapes, and hardware, but the Epiphone line was somewhat upgraded, with inlaid logos and a 2x2 peghead configuration. The Matsumoku factory had been producing guitars for export for some time, but the 1820 bass (alongside a number of guitar models and the 5120 electric acoustic bass) were the first Epiphone models to be made there. So it is hard to generalise, although some might argue that the darker sound of humbucking pickups in a mahogany body and neck with rosewood fingerboard is the signature sound of a Gibson bass. There are humbuckers and single coil pickups. There are mahogany, maple and alder bodies. Models with set-necks, bolt-on necks, and through-body necks. There are long scale and short scale basses. As a result, there is significant variation across the range of basses Gibson created, in looks, build, electronics, and ultimately sound. Unlike Fender, who produced just a few bass models, but continuously over 50 years ( Fender Precision, Fender Jazz bass), Gibson was continually creating new bass models, most with relatively short production periods. So the Gibson bass was shaped, and finished like an upright, and with an extendable pole at the bass so it could even be played upright. The fact that they made a solid-body bass at all in this climate is surprising, but Fender solid body sales were sufficiently high to make Gibson take notice. Their view was that guitars should be large jazz boxes, and the bass should be upright and acoustic solid body instruments were for Fender, not Gibson. The incident had a profound impact on Le Bon, one of the biggest popstars of the 1980s who just one month before had performed to a worldwide television audience of 1.5 billion as part of Live Aid. ![]() Although the alarm was raised straight away by another yacht, Carat, the men were stuck inside the upturned yacht for 40 minutes until they were rescued. The boat capsized, trapping Le Bon and five other crew members inside. He was asleep aboard his 78-foot maxi-yacht Drum when the keel broke off the hull due to a design failure. Le Bon, front man of iconic 1980s British pop band, was competing in the Fastnet yacht race – a 608-mile round trip between the Isle of Wight and Plymouth off Britain’s southwest coast. The feminine vocals of Tessa Niles on the pre-chorus lines of ‘Can’t ever keep from falling apart at the seams / Can not believe you’ve taken my heart to pieces’ contrast with Le Bon’s deeper tones, as he sings about falling so deeply in love with somebody that you ‘come undone’ completely. The track, a gorgeous, romantic ballad, was written by frontman Simon Le Bon for his wife, supermodel Yasmin Le Bon as a birthday gift, even featuring the lyrics ‘Happy birthday to you / was created for you’. Their follow-up single, ‘Come Undone’, repeated this renewed 1990s chart success for the band. For the first time since the mid-eighties, their tracks and albums were charting highly again! The album peaked at number four on the UK albums chart, and its first single, ‘Ordinary World’, charted at number six on the singles chart. Despite this resistance to their musical return in favour of newer artists, the band persisted and released the album in November 1993. The cover of Duran Duran’s 1993 album ‘Duran Duran’ (The Wedding Album), via Parlophone/EMI Recordsįollowing the unsuccessful 1990 album Liberty, Duran Duran began working on Duran Duran (known as ‘The Wedding Album’ to differentiate it from their 1981 debut album of the same name), to a general atmosphere of unenthusiasm from the record industry.
